The Cup Chase ins and outs and maybes - 1-14 are clinched, Newman and Biffle are currently in on points, while Bowyer and Larson still have a chance to get in on points. And any first time winner for 2014 will knock out the bubble position. So the last two spots are still very fluid.
  1. 24-Jeff Gordon, 3 wins, 1st in points
  2. 88-Dale Earnhardt Jr., 3 wins, 2nd
  3. 22-Joey Logano, 3 wins, 4th
  4. 2-Brad Keselowski, 3 wins, 5th
  5. 48-Jimmie Johnson, 3 wins, 6th
  6. 99-Carl Edwards, 2 wins, 7th
  7. 4-Kevin Harvick, 2 wins, 8th
  8. 5-Kasey Kahne, 1 win, 11th
  9. 18-Kyle Busch, 1 win, 17th
  10. 11-Denny Hamlin, 1 win, 19th
  11. 41-Kurt Busch, 1 win, 21st
  12. 43-Aric Almirola, 1 win, 22nd
  13. 47-A.J. Allmendinger, 1 win, 23r
  14. 20-Matt Kenseth, no wins, 5th in drivers points
  15. 31-Ryan Newman, 9th, +42 points
  16. 16-Greg Biffle, 10th, +23 points
  17. 15-Clint Bowyer, 12th, -23 points
  18. 42-Kyle Larson, 13th, -24 points
News
  • Beginning 1 January, the Nascar Nationwide series is no more. The new sponsor is Comcast through their Xfinity brand, So it will be the Nascar Xfinity series or NXS.
  • Turner Scott Motorsports has shut down the the #30 team of Ron Hornaday. Apparently Turner and Scott are having some legal disagreements. I say that because they are suing each other.

Richmond fence climber arrested, charged UPDATE: An unidentified fan made it all the way to the top of the catchfence in Turn 4, bringing out a caution during Saturday night's Federated Auto Parts 400. Richmond International Raceway spokeswoman Aimee Turner said the unidentified fan was arrested by Henrico County police and charged with disorderly conduct and being drunk in public. The fan sat atop the fence while the 42-car field zoomed underneath him at speeds upward of 120 mph. Asked how the fan got past security to climb the fence, Turner said the track will "review safety measures with Henrico (County) police and NASCAR." She said officers were stationed along the fence in front of the grandstands. One of those officers can be seen in photos on social media looking the opposite direction as the fan sits atop the fence. A video shows the fan getting past a cordoned area and climbing. The caution lights did not come on until after the climber had begun his descent, after sitting atop the fencing for several minutes. Police officers surrounded him at that point.(more at the USA Today)(9-7-2014)

UPDATE: Henrico County police identified the spectator who climbed to the top of the catchfence during Saturday night's Sprint Cup NASCAR race at Richmond International Raceway as James Richard Dennis, 53, of Henrico. Dennis was arrested and charged with being drunk in public and disorderly conduct. Henrico police Lt. Scott Jones said Dennis told police it was his birthday and he wanted to be on national TV. "He's up in the stands and he's waiting for his chance," Jones said. "When the officers are tied up on something else, when the officers walk away, he runs down, climbs the fence, all the way to top, starts waving, and he got his wish."(News & Advance)(9-8-2014)
